Which landmarks are on the route and where to spot the best photos

Begin near Arena di Verona for sunrise shots; cross Ponte Pietra for reflections on calm waters; Castelvecchio Bridge provides bold brick lines against sky; this route is a showcase of back italy pace and modern vibes, ideal for romantic frames wiv heart.

From there, Piazza Bra offers lively panoramas; climb Lamberti Tower for sweeping views over rooftops; crypt In Basilica di San Zeno and nearby churches yield moody interiors; a nearby музей adds context to craft and daily life; structure hints show how brick and timber shape silhouette.

Quieter times of year

March through May, plus September through October, provide mild temperatures for cycling; July through August bring heat, crowds rise; opt for mornings or late afternoons. Weekday slots boost mobility; peak times avoided.
